Lynda puts her foot in it, while Emma treads carefully.
Ed tells Eddie about his job offer from Adam, but admits he needs more time to think about it. Ed explains that he doesn't want Emma to know as it's still a sore spot for her.
Emma's annoyed that Joe's offered to look after Ruby during the honeymoon. She's afraid this might cause problems with their own dog Holly. Eddie admits Joe's been offered money.
Later, at Ambridge view Emma tells Susan about Ed's job offer, Susan insists she should put her foot down and not let Ed turn down the offer. Later, Ed confesses to Emma that he fears he'd lose his independence accepting the job, as well as the money not paying for a mortgage. Emma suggests asking Adam for a bit more money.
The village hall boiler has broken just in time for the pantomime rehearsal; Lynda suggests calling Phillip Moss to fix the boiler but in the meantime offers up her conservatory for one night only. The conservatory works well, however it doesn't take long before Lynda returns to her usual over the top adlibbing, much to everyone's annoyance. The final straw comes when Lynda mentions Susan's stint in prison that Alan finally agrees to have a word with her.
